Imaginative Halloween Styles

Take into consideration styles such as "Haunted Forest," where participants browse through a scary setup decorated with synthetic webs, creepy sound impacts, and macabre numbers. A "Witch's Mixture" motif might include potion-inspired difficulties and hints concealed within cauldrons or spell books, motivating imagination in idea layout.
One more engaging option is "Traditional Horror Motion Pictures," where individuals search for clues or items connected to legendary films, such as Dracula, Frankenstein, or The Mummy. This style enables timeless references and can trigger intriguing discussions amongst individuals.
For a lighter approach, the "Pumpkin Patch" motif can include enjoyable and wayward components, including lively challenges focused around pumpkin-related activities. Whichever style you choose, ensure it reverberates with your target market, developing an ambience of exhilaration that makes the scavenger quest an emphasize of the Halloween festivities.

Safety Tips for Individuals
Individuals should prioritize safety during the Halloween scavenger hunt to make certain a fun and pleasurable experience for everybody included. It is vital to develop boundaries for the scavenger quest area. Plainly define the limits to stay clear of participants wandering into hazardous or unfamiliar areas.
Urge individuals to clothe suitably for the weather condition and environment, selecting comfortable footwear to prevent slips and drops. Costumes must be well-fitted and not impede movement; prevent masks that obstruct vision or devices that could be harmful.
Additionally, individuals need to stay in teams, as this improves safety and makes certain that every person keeps an eye out for each other. Develop a check-in system to make up all participants, particularly kids, that must be accompanied by a grown-up in all times.
Lastly, be conscious of the time, making certain the scavenger hunt concludes prior to dark. Offer sufficient lights and reflectors to raise exposure if tasks extend into the night. By sticking to these safety and security resource ideas, individuals can fully immerse themselves in the Halloween spirit while enjoying a safe and exciting scavenger search experience.
Reward Concepts for Victors
As the enjoyment of the Halloween scavenger quest builds, recognizing the efforts of individuals with tempting rewards can improve motivation and enjoyment. Selecting the best benefits can elevate the experience and urge friendly competitors among individuals of every ages.
Take into consideration using Halloween-themed rewards, such as ornamental pumpkins, spooky candles, or themed gift baskets full of treats sweet corn and chocolate bars. Furthermore, little playthings or ornaments, like glow-in-the-dark accessories or Halloween stickers, can interest more youthful individuals. For grownups, take into consideration present certifications to neighborhood restaurants or shops, or a bottle of seasonal white wine to celebrate their triumph.
An additional involving alternative is to give experience-based rewards, such as tickets to a regional haunted home or a family pass to a pumpkin patch. These prizes not just award champions yet additionally urge ongoing involvement in neighborhood events.
For a more individualized touch, produce custom-made certificates or trophies that identify accomplishments in numerous groups, such as "Finest Group Spirit" or "A Lot Of Creative Costume." These thoughtful gestures can make the occasion unforgettable and foster a feeling of friendship among participants.
